heise Developer
87 subscribers
8.09K links
Informationen für Entwickler

Powered by @DerNewsChannel
Download Telegram
C++ Core Guidelines: Programmierung zur Compilezeit mit constexpr
#CC

Diese Serie zur Programmierung zur Compilezeit begann mit der Template-Metaprogrammierung, gefolgt von der Type-Traits-Bibliothek und endet heute mit konstanten Ausdrücken (constexpr).

Teilen 👉 @DerNewsBot hdev6
Vault für Entwickler: Geheimnisse in Webanwendungen schützen
#HashiCorp #Sicherheit #Softwareentwicklung #Vault

Fast jede Webanwendung sorgt selbst für das sichere Speichern von Zugangsdaten. Vault ist eine Alternative, die in Entwicklungsumgebungen ohne großen Administrationsaufwand funktioniert.

Teilen 👉 @DerNewsBot hdev7
Faktencheck zu Progressive Web Apps, Teil 3: Offenheit und Abwärtskompatibilität
#ProgressiveWebApps

Im vergangenen Teil dieser Serie ging es um die Privatsphäre und Sicherheit zeitgemäßer Webschnittstellen. Zahlreiche neue Webschnittstellen sollen Progressive Web Apps mit noch mehr Features ausstatten. In diesem Teil geht es um die Offenheit und Abwärtskompatibilität dieser APIs.

Teilen 👉 @DerNewsBot hdev8
Weboberflächenentwicklung mit Elm
#Elixir #Erlang #Phoenix #Webentwicklung

Sollen sich Clientanwendungen für verteilte Applikation sicher und ohne Laufzeitfehler ausführen lassen, bietet sich die funktionale Programmiersprache Elm an. Eine Beispielanwendung zeigt ihr serverseitiges Zusammenspiel mit Elixir und dem Webserver Phoenix.

Teilen 👉 @DerNewsBot hdev9
C++ Core Guidelines: Weitere Regeln zu Templates
#CC

Da sich die verbleibenden Regeln zu Templates nicht unter einem gemeinsamen Begriff zusammenfassen lassen, sind die heterogenen Regeln in dem Abschnitt "other" der C++ Core Guidelines gelandet. Diese beschäftigen sich mit Best Practices und Überraschungen.

Teilen 👉 @DerNewsBot hdev10
Ed Burns: "Container waren zur rechten Zeit am rechten Ort"
#Containerisierung #Docker #Java #JavaServerFaces #Kubernetes

Ed Burns, Co-Spec Lead der JavaServer Faces, im Gespräch über seinen Werdegang sowie seine kommende Keynote auf dem JavaLand 2019.

Teilen 👉 @DerNewsBot hdev11
Episode 59: Domain-driven Design (DDD)
#DomainDrivenDesign

Gernot Starke, Carola Lilienthal und Eberhard Wolff beschäftigen sich in dieser Episode des SoftwareArchitekTOUR-Podcast mit Domain-driven Design (DDD).

Teilen 👉 @DerNewsBot hdev12
Data Storytelling: Datenerkenntnisse sichtbar machen
#DataAnalytics #DataScience

Im Kontext einer Geschichte erscheinen die Erkenntnisse von Datenanalysen leichter verständlich und nachvollziehbarer. Ein Zuviel oder Zuwenig an Information birgt dabei jedoch die Gefahr der Verzerrung – sowohl für den Erzähler als auch den Zuhörer.

Teilen 👉 @DerNewsBot hdev13
C++ Core Guidelines: Überraschung inklusive mit der Spezialisierung von Funktions-Templates
#CC

Der Abschluss der Regeln der C++ Core Guidelines zu Templates mit einer großen Überraschung für viele C++-Entwickler. Es geht um die Spezialisierung von Funktions-Templates.

Teilen 👉 @DerNewsBot hdev14
DevOps braucht Multi-Cloud – und umgekehrt
#CloudComputing #DevOps #MultiCloud

Die Einführung von DevOps in Unternehmen scheitert meist, wenn sie innerhalb der klassischen Entwickler- und Betriebseinheiten erfolgt. Die Multi-Cloud kann hier für den notwendigen Schwung sorgen.

Teilen 👉 @DerNewsBot hdev15
Mein Scrum ist kaputt #69: 100 Leute haben wir gefragt ... Agilien-Duell-Nachbesprechung (Teil 2)
#Agile #Agilität #Scrum

Wenn man 100 Leute zu Agilität befragt, kommen mitunter skurrile Antworten heraus: Der zweite Teil der Analyse des Agilien-Duells schließt die Serie ab.

Teilen 👉 @DerNewsBot hdev16
Cast erstellt mit Software Heritage Index für Herkunft von Sourcecode
#Analyse #OpenSource

Mit dem Herkunftsindex sollen Unternehmen erkennen, welche frei verfügbaren Komponenten ihr Code enthält.

Teilen 👉 @DerNewsBot hdev17
Faktencheck zu Progressive Web Apps, Teil 4: Grenzen & Auswege
#ProgressiveWebApps

Im vorigen Teil dieser Serie rund um häufig gestellte Fragen zu Progressive Web Apps rückten die Themen Offenheit und Abwärtskompatibilität moderner Webschnittstellen in den Vordergrund. In diesem vorerst letzten Teil geht es um die Grenzen des PWA-Anwendungsmodells und mögliche Auswege, falls Entwickler an eine solche stoßen sollten.

Teilen 👉 @DerNewsBot hdev18
Continuous Lifecycle London: Jetzt noch Frühbucherrabatt sichern
#Containerisierung #ContinuousDelivery #ContinuousLifecycleLondon #DevOps

Wer von zahlreichen Vorträgen zu den Themen Continuous Delivery, DevOps und Containerisierung profitieren möchte, kann noch bis zum 28. Februar Geld sparen.

Teilen 👉 @DerNewsBot hdev19
KI: OpenAI will Sozialwissenschaftler in die Forschung einbeziehen
#KünstlicheIntelligenz #MachineLearning #Sozialwissenschaft

Die Forschungseinrichtung erläutert in einer Abhandlung, warum Sozialwissenschaftler für die KI-Entwicklung wichtig sind.

Teilen 👉 @DerNewsBot hdev20
Folge der Übernahme: Idera entlässt offenbar viele Travis-Mitarbeiter
#Idera #TravisCI

Schon sehr kurze Zeit nach der Übernahmen verlieren anscheinend etliche Mitarbeiter der Firma hinter dem Continuous-Integration-System Travis CI den Job.

Teilen 👉 @DerNewsBot hdev21
The React Handbook
#JavaScript #Literatur #React

Die wichtigsten Aspekte rund um die React-Bibliothek und deren Ökosystem fasst das regelmäßig aktualisierte und frei verfügbare E-Book von Flavio Copes zusammen – in kurzen, gut verständlichen Abschnitten.

Teilen 👉 @DerNewsBot hdev22
JavaScript: npm eröffnet neues Angebot für Enterprise-Kunden
#JavaScript #npm #paketmanager

Das Unternehmensangebot des Paketmanagers npm schafft den Sprung aus der Beta und soll Kunden mehr Sicherheit und bessere Integration in ihre Workflows bieten.

Teilen 👉 @DerNewsBot hdev23
Android-Apps müssen ab Sommer strengeren API-Vorgaben folgen
#API #Android #AndroidPie #Google

Die Anpassung auf die API für Android 9 dient vor allem der besseren Sicherheit. Die Vorgaben gelten ab Sommer beziehungsweise Herbst.

Teilen 👉 @DerNewsBot hdev24
KI: Linux Foundation nimmt Ubers Programmiersprache Pyro unter ihre Fittiche
#KünstlicheIntelligenz #LinuxFoundation #MachineLearning #Programmiersprachen #Uber

Die von Uber initiierte probabilistische Programmiersprache Pyro ist ab sofort ein Inkubator-Projekt der LF Deep Learning Foundation.

Teilen 👉 @DerNewsBot hdev24
Redis ändert Lizenzstruktur – erneut
#OpenSource #Redis

Die Einführung des Commons-Clause-Lizenzmodells bei der In-Memory-Datenbank ist nicht auf Gegenliebe gestoßen. Jetzt probiert man es mit einer neuen Lizenz.

Teilen 👉 @DerNewsBot hdev24